A new campaign to protect vulnerable people has been launched by Haringey Council.

There are vulnerable adults in the borough who aren't able to care for themselves without support and who can become victims of abuse.

The campaign is promoting a new team being set up specifically dedicated to tackling this problem. Previously any issues were dealt with by individual social workers.

Adult abuse can take many forms:

  • physical, including hitting, slapping and kicking
  • sexual, including inappropriate touching and language
  • psychological, including threats of harm or humiliation
  • financial exploitation, including theft, fraud or pressure over wills
  • neglect, including ignoring medical or physical needs
  • all forms of discrimination.

The abuse can take place anywhere at any time, but there are some simple warning signs to look out for: bruises, neglect such as dirty clothes, changes in someone's financial situation or changes in their behaviour such as loss of confidence or nervousness.

Any allegation of abuse will be investigated, with immediate action taken if needed to protect the individual. If needed, extra help will be provided or the victim will be put in a place of safety to ensure that they're no longer at risk.
